About the Role

The Product Management Intern will support the Global Commercial Services (GCS) product vision by owning the product strategy for a commercial product. This role involves identifying customer needs, building outstanding experiences, and leading partners to manage and market products within a fast-paced team driving commercial customer solutions.

Responsibilities

  • Own the product strategy for one of our commercial products.
  • Play a central role identifying customer needs.
  • Build outstanding experiences.
  • Lead partners to manage and market these products.

About the Company

  • Global Commercial Services (GCS) serves millions of business customers around the world, from mom-and-pop shops to Fortune 500 companies.
  • GCS has a mission to be the undisputed leader in financial and membership services, responsibly driving double-digit revenue growth.
  • GCS offers a diverse range of payment and cashflow tools, including traditional card products, working capital and supply chain financing, and new digital solutions.
